Hi everyone, So I think it would be a really good idea to go for gtk3 in oneiric: - it allows us to focus on one ui rather than having to work on gtk2 as well (also avoids all that gobject vs GObject stuff of the last few days) - there were many changes between gtk2 and gtk3 and gtk3.1 which generally took quite a while to figure out how to do things the new way - as time has gone on generally more and more things have started working, and once you have figured out how they worked, they work solidly until the api changes again - so it should be quite safe for oneiric - the fixes we have been making recently have generally been smaller fixes rather than larger fixes - in the sense of some of them have been fixing larger things, but it's not as if we have been rewriting large chunks of code to fix bugs - it's new and sparkly and shiny :)
Things to keep in mind are amongst others: - a11y will presumably need fixing - rtl seems to work fairly nicely, could probably use a check every now and then - custom lists need reimplementing (again.. ;)) - although s-c-gtk3 has been in the archives for a while, we haven't been getting any apport bugs for it - in general the apport bugs are smallish fixes, so that should be ok though, but presumably there will be quite a few of them - performance isn't stunning (ie loading and switching panes)- having said that, it isn't significantly slow either, so that's something we can work on next cycle with a lot of help from the new db backend (if I manage to finish it nicely) - I'm not sure what the plan is for oneconf atm - there is an interface implemented against s-c-gtk2, but that hasn't had any testing as there isn't a server yet (afaik?), so I'm not sure whether that's something that needs to be rewritten for gtk3 or if that's a 'next cycle' thing, again :/ - I'm not sure what the status is of the exhibits is either, so that may still need a bit of work - details view needs theming, and it would be nice to make the theming of the lobby vs lists vs details slightly more consistent, ie atm it's kind of orange semi-busy vs white minimalistic vs greyscale So although there is still a lot to do for the gtk3 interface, I think we will be able to solve the vast majority of the remaining issues within the next month and look forward to changing to the gtk3 interface and discontinuing the gtk2 one.
